首页 / 国外VPS推荐 / 正文
全面解析与实战指南Web服务器IIS的配置、优化与安全管理

Time:2025年03月31日 Read:6 评论:0 作者:y21dr45

关键词:Web服务器IIS

全面解析与实战指南Web服务器IIS的配置、优化与安全管理

---

一、为什么选择IIS作为Web服务器?

Internet Information Services(简称IIS)是微软推出的高性能Web服务器平台,广泛用于托管ASP.NET网站、静态页面及RESTful API服务。根据W3Techs统计数据显示(截至2023年) ,全球约7.2%的网站运行在IIS上 ,尤其在Windows Server生态中占据主导地位 。其优势包括:

- 深度集成Windows系统 :支持Active Directory认证、组策略管理;

- 图形化操作界面 :通过“服务器管理器”可快速完成部署;

- 模块化架构 :按需启用HTTP重定向、动态压缩等功能;

- 企业级扩展性 :兼容负载均衡方案(如ARR模块)与云原生部署(Azure适配)。

二、从零开始搭建IIS环境

1. 安装流程(以Windows Server 2022为例)

- 通过GUI安装

1. 打开“服务器管理器” → “添加角色和功能”;

2. 勾选“Web服务器(IIS)” → 按需选择子功能(如ASP.NET);

3. 完成安装后访问 `http://localhost` 验证默认页。

- PowerShell一键部署

```powershell

Install-WindowsFeature -Name Web-Server -IncludeManagementTools

```

2. 基础配置要点

- 创建网站

1. IIS管理器中右键“网站” → “添加网站”;

2. 指定站点名称、物理路径(建议非系统盘)、绑定类型(HTTP/HTTPS);

3. 设置应用程序池为独立进程以隔离资源。

- 关键参数说明

- 绑定(Binding) :支持多域名/IP+端口组合;

- 应用程序池(Application Pool) :设置.NET CLR版本及托管管道模式;

- 默认文档(Default Document) :定义首页优先级顺序(如index.html)。

三、性能优化实战技巧

▶️ HTTP响应加速策略

- 启用动态内容压缩

路径:IIS管理器 → “压缩” →勾选“启用动态内容压缩”。

- 输出缓存(Output Caching)

针对静态资源设置规则(如缓存CSS文件30天):

```xml

▶️ 资源占用控制

- 调整应用程序池参数

1. “回收”设置 →固定时间间隔回收内存;

2. “进程模型” →限制最大工作进程数(应对高并发);

- 连接数限制

在站点级“限制”中设置最大并发连接数 ,防止DDoS攻击导致的资源耗尽。

四、安全加固必做清单

▶️ HTTPS强制跳转

1. 申请并安装SSL证书(推荐Let's Encrypt免费证书);

2. URL重写规则强制HTTPS:

▶️ 攻击防护措施

- 请求筛选(Request Filtering)

屏蔽敏感路径(如`/admin`)的匿名访问;

- IP白名单控制

通过“IPv4地址和域限制”仅允许可信IP段;

- 日志审计

开启W3C日志记录格式 ,定期分析`%SystemDrive%\inetpub\logs\LogFiles`目录下的日志文件 。

五、常见故障排查指南

| 错误代码 | 可能原因 | 解决方案 |

|--------------|----------------------------|---------------------------------------|

| HTTP Error 503 | 应用程序池崩溃 | 检查事件查看器→重启池→升级.NET框架 |

| HTTP Error 404 | URL重写规则冲突 | 禁用第三方模块→逐步排查规则逻辑 |

| HTTP Error 401 | NTFS权限不足 | IIS_IUSRS组授予站点目录读取权限 |

六、未来趋势:云原生时代的IIS演进

随着Kubernetes与容器技术的普及 ,微软已推出适用于Windows容器的IIS镜像 (如`mcr.microsoft.com/windows/servercore/iis`)。结合Azure App Service的自动化扩展能力 ,开发者可实现混合环境下的无缝迁移 。

---

【结语】

掌握Web服务器IIS的核心运维技能 ,不仅能提升站点稳定性 ,更能为业务增长提供可靠保障 。建议定期备份`applicationHost.config`配置文件 ,并通过Windows Update保持补丁更新 。如需深入交流 ,欢迎关注我的技术博客获取最新实战案例!

TAG:web服务器iis,web服务器iis怎么打开,web服务器iis的作用是什么,web服务器iis ftp,WEB服务器的主要功能是

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1